2. Position turn signal switch in right turn position, then
remove actuator arm screw and actuator arm (Fig. 3B4-49).

3. Remove turn signal switch lever, pull straight out to
disengage (Fig. 3B4-50).

4. Push in on hazard warning knob, then remove screw
and hazard warning knob.
5. Lift up on tilt lever and position housing in center
position, then remove the three turn signal switch attaching
screws (Fig. 384-5 1).
6. Remove instrument panel lower trim cap or lower
trim panel, then disconnect turn signal connector from
harness (Fig. 384-14). Lift connector from mounting bracket

on right side of jacket.
7. Remove toe-pan bolts.
8. Remove the four bolts "W", "X", "Y" and "Z"
attaching bracket assembly to jacket (Fig. 3B4-2).
9. Remove shift indicator retaining clip.
10. Remove the two nuts "A" and "B" from bracket
assembly. While holding column in position, remove bracket
assembly, remove wire protector from turn signal wiring.
11. Tape turn signal switch wires at connector keeping
wires flat and parallel, then carefully pull turn signal switch
and wiring from top end of column.
12. Position lock assembly in "Run" position. Insert a
thin tool (small screwdriver or knife blade) into the slot next
to the switch mounting screw boss (right hand slot) and
depress retainer at bottom of slot, which releases lock.
Remove lock (Fig. 3B4-52).
13. Remove key warning buzzer switch out of housing
using a straight paper clip or similar piece of stiff wire with
a hook bent on one end (Fig. 3B4-53).
NOTE: It may be necessary to reach inside cover bore
and depress contacts so switch can be removed.
14. Unscrew tilt lever and remove.
15. Remove the three cover to housing attaching screws
and remove cover (Fig. 3B4-54).
16. With cover removed, cap and rod actuator may be
removed (Fig. 384-55).
17. T o remove pivot assembly, remove pivot pin, then
pivot assembly from cover (Fig. 384-56).
18. Reinstall tilt release lever and place column, in full
tilt "up"
position. Remove tilt spring retainer using
screwdriver blade that just fits into slot opening. Insert
screwdriver in slot, press in approximately 3/1.6", turn
approximately 1/8 turn counterclockwise until ears align
with grooves in housing and remove spring and guide (Fig.
3B4-3 1).
19. Remove dimmer switch mounting screw and remove
dimmer switch (Fig. 3B4-57).
20. Place ignition switch in the "ACC" position by
pulling actuator rod with pliers in the full downward position
towards ignition switch. Remove ignition switch.
